The Department of Veterans Affairs Network Contracting Office 8 in West Palm Beach, FL plans to award a sole source purchase order to LBT Diagnostic Radiation Physics Consulting Ltd., a verified Service Disabled Veteran Owned Small Business (SDVOSB), for physicist survey services of radiation equipment. This contract covers annual radiation physics quality assurance inspections for diagnostic imaging systems such as X-ray, ultrasound, MRI, PET/CT, and nuclear medicine equipment, requiring a qualified and credentialed diagnostic medical physicist to ensure compliance with ACR and MQSA standards. The contract's estimated total value over five years, including base and four one-year options, is approximately $309,000. The sole source award is authorized under 38 U.S.C. 8127(b) and VAAR 819.7008, as LBT meets all technical and regulatory requirements, has demonstrated successful prior performance on identical VA contracts, and market research confirmed its capability for immediate performance. This action is not a solicitation for competitive offers, though any capability statements received may be reviewed to determine if a future competitive procurement is needed. The contracting officer has determined the price to be fair and reasonable, and the procurement falls below the Simplified Acquisition Threshold or within the specified regulatory limits for sole source SDVOSB awards. Subject: Notice of Intent to Award a Sole Source Purchase Order to a Service Disabled Veteran Owned Small Business (SDVOSB) Requirement: Physicist Survey of Radiation Equipment Agency: Department of Veterans Affairs, NCO 8 West Palm Beach, FL The Department of Veterans Affairs, Network Contracting Office (NCO) 8, intends to award a sole source purchase order to a verified Service Disabled Veteran Owned Small Business (SDVOSB) in accordance with 38 U.S.C. 8127(b) and VAAR 819.7008. The requirement is for Physicist Survey of Radiation Equipment, including annual radiation physics quality assurance inspections for diagnostic imaging systems (x ray, ultrasound, MRI, PET/CT, and nuclear medicine equipment). These services must be performed by a qualified diagnostic medical physicist trained and credentialed to ensure compliance with ACR and MQSA standards. The VA intends to award to: LBT Diagnostic Radiation Physics Consulting Ltd. SDVOSB Verified Total 5 Year Value Estimate Base + 4 one Year options : $309,000.00 A sole source award is authorized because: LBT is a verified SDVOSB capable of meeting all technical and regulatory requirements. Under 38 U.S.C. 8127(b), the VA may award directly to a SDVOSB when the Contracting Officer determines the price is fair and reasonable, and the award is below the Simplified Acquisition Threshold (SAT) or within VAAR 819.7008 thresholds. The contractor has demonstrated successful performance on prior VA contracts for identical services. Market research confirms that LBT Radiation Physics meets all technical requirements and is capable of immediate performance. This notice is not a request for competitive offers. No solicitation is available. Any capability statements received may be evaluated solely for the purpose of determining whether to conduct a future competitive procurement. However, the Government intends to proceed with this SDVOSB sole source action unless it is determined that other SDVOSB vendors are capable of meeting the requirement.
